''All the XEP in PDF''
''All the XEP in PDF''


[http://ayena.de Tobias Markmann] has written a XEP publishing mechanism that generates the XEP in PDF format, with syntax highlighting for example stanzas. You can now download each one of them, read them while offline, and distribute them. You can also get the full pack as a tarball: [http://xmpp.org/extensions/xepbundle.tar.bz2 xepbundle.tar.bz2]
